The collaboration between Bangladesh and the Netherlands focuses on resilient societies and institutions.
The Netherlands has been a strong supporter of the humanitarian response for Rohinya refugees in Bangladesh.
The Netherlands’ agenda on sensitive issues centers around establishing women’s rights.
The Netherlands and Bangladesh are long-lasting and trusted partners in doing sustainable, inclusive and responsible business together.
Watermanagement and sustainable agricultural practices are important for both Delta countries.
This plan, developed in close cooperation with the Netherlands, is based on the vision to achieve safe, climate resilient and prosperous Delta by the year 2100.
